Calcul de dates

minoucha.B - 18 sept. 2013 à 10:47
jordane45 Messages postés 38145 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 25 avril 2024 - 18 sept. 2013 à 11:05
Bonjour,

j'ai deux dates par exemple
SET @d='2013-01-01'
SET @t='2016-03-09'
et je vais calculer la différence mais seulement pour les années, dans ce cas 3 ans et pourquoi pas en mois donc 36 mois.

qu'est ce que je dois faire?

merci

2 réponses

C'est bien.... j'ai trouvé la solution ;)
0
jordane45 Messages postés 38145 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 25 avril 2024 344
Modifié par jordane45 le 18/09/2013 à 11:05
Bonjour,

calculer la différence .....pourquoi pas en mois ...
MONTH_BETWEEN(date1, date2).

Sinon, vous pouvez regarder ICI
http://www.codeproject.com/Tips/519083/Get-Duration-Between-Two-Dates-in-Years-Months-Day

Ou là:
http://www.w3schools.com/sql/func_datediff.asp

Mais bon, sinon vous avez aussi ce lien
SQl+years+betwwen+2+dates
Cordialement,
Jordane
0
Rejoignez-nous